Cybersecurity: The rise of agentsic AI
Agentic AI can be that refers to autonomous, goal-oriented robots that can detect their environment, take the right decisions, and execute actions for the purpose of achieving specific desired goals. Agentic AI is different from conventional reactive or rule-based AI as it can be able to learn and adjust to its environment, and also operate on its own. In the field of cybersecurity, that autonomy transforms into AI agents who continuously monitor networks and detect abnormalities, and react to attacks in real-time without the need for constant human intervention.
Agentic AI offers enormous promise in the field of cybersecurity. These intelligent agents are able to identify patterns and correlates by leveraging machine-learning algorithms, along with large volumes of data. Intelligent agents are able to sort through the chaos generated by several security-related incidents by prioritizing the crucial and provide insights that can help in rapid reaction. Agentic AI systems have the ability to develop and enhance their abilities to detect security threats and changing their strategies to match cybercriminals and their ever-changing tactics.

Artificial Intelligence Powers Intelligent Fixing
Perhaps the most interesting application of agentic AI in AppSec is automated vulnerability fix. When a flaw has been identified, it is on the human developer to examine the code, identify the problem, then implement fix. This can take a long time as well as error-prone. It often can lead to delays in the implementation of crucial security patches.
ai secure pipeline is a game changer. game is changed. Utilizing the extensive knowledge of the codebase offered through the CPG, AI agents can not just detect weaknesses and create context-aware not-breaking solutions automatically. They can analyse all the relevant code in order to comprehend its function and then craft a solution which fixes the issue while creating no new problems.
The benefits of AI-powered auto fix are significant. It is estimated that the time between the moment of identifying a vulnerability before addressing the issue will be significantly reduced, closing an opportunity for criminals. It can also relieve the development team of the need to devote countless hours fixing security problems. They can concentrate on creating fresh features. Automating the process of fixing security vulnerabilities allows organizations to ensure that they're using a reliable and consistent method and reduces the possibility to human errors and oversight.
What are the issues as well as the importance of considerations?
The potential for agentic AI for cybersecurity and AppSec is vast but it is important to recognize the issues and issues that arise with its adoption. In the area of accountability as well as trust is an important one. As AI agents are more autonomous and capable of making decisions and taking action in their own way, organisations have to set clear guidelines and oversight mechanisms to ensure that the AI performs within the limits of behavior that is acceptable. It is essential to establish reliable testing and validation methods in order to ensure the quality and security of AI generated corrections.
Another concern is the potential for adversarial attacks against the AI itself. When agent-based AI technology becomes more common in the world of cybersecurity, adversaries could try to exploit flaws in AI models or manipulate the data upon which they're taught. This underscores the importance of secure AI methods of development, which include techniques like adversarial training and modeling hardening.
Furthermore, the efficacy of agentic AI within AppSec depends on the completeness and accuracy of the code property graph. In order to build and keep an accurate CPG You will have to invest in techniques like static analysis, test frameworks, as well as pipelines for integration. Organizations must also ensure that they are ensuring that their CPGs correspond to the modifications occurring in the codebases and evolving security landscapes.
